>-----Original Message-----
>I get to the windows loading screen and it just sits
there for a while and
>loads and loads then finally it goes to a screen that
says something like a
>recent hardware of software change might have caused
this. Then is gives safe
>mode options and last know good configuration for the
startup choices and
>NONE OF THEM WORK!!!!
>So I attempted a repair with the windows disk. and when
i press "R" to go to
>the the repair thing it freezes on examining my
harddrive. Then I even went
>in and tried to do a full reinstall of windows and it
did the same thing.
>right before this started happening i did virus scan no
problems and ad-ware
>scan with no problems had firewall and everything. I
dont think that it is
>sp2 because i have had it for about 2 weeks without any
problems.
>
>ANYONE KNOW WHAT THE JEEBUS IS WRONG?!?!?
>.
>Could be a hard drive failing. Maybe some bad memory? Go
to memtest86.com and download memtest to floppy. Put the
floppy in and boot your machine. Give it at least 12
hours.
